Stotzard is a parish village and part of the market Aindling in the district of Aichach-Friedberg , which belongs to the administrative district of Swabia in Bavaria . In the local West Central Bavarian dialect, the place is called Stouzad .
geography
Stotzard is located southeast of Aindling on the plateau of the Lower Lechrain of the Aindlinger Terrassentreppe . In terms of natural space, it belongs to the Donau-Iller-Lech-Platte , which in turn is part of the Alpine foothills , one of the main natural spatial units in Germany .
The neighboring towns of Stotzard are directly south of Gaulzhofen , in the north the main town Aindling and Arnhofen , in the east Hausen and Weichenberg and in the west Rehling and its district Allmering .
history
The Catholic parish Sankt Peter in Stotzard belongs to the parish community Rehling in the deanery Aichach-Friedberg in the diocese of Augsburg. The parish also includes Arnhofen , Gaulzhofen , Hausen , Neßlach and Rohrbach .
Until October 1, 1971, Stotzard was an independent municipality in the Aichach district and was then incorporated into the Aindling market as part of the regional reform in Bavaria . On July 1, 1972, Aindling and its districts were added to the newly founded Aichach-Friedberg district, which until May 1, 1973 was called the Augsburg-Ost district .

Personalities
- Caspar Huberinus (* 1500 in Stotzard, † 1553 in Öhringen ), Protestant theologian, author of the edification, hymn poet and reformer
